Teen bedrooms are a reflection of their personalities, interests, and aspirations. As trends evolve, so does the way teens express themselves through their bedroom decor. From vibrant colors to minimalist aesthetics, the choices they make reflect the changing landscape of youth culture.

Popular Themes

Teen bedroom wall decor often reflects popular themes and interests. These themes can range from pop culture icons to artistic expressions.

  • Music: Music posters, band logos, and lyrics are popular choices for teens who are passionate about music.
  • Movies and TV Shows: Posters, artwork, and tapestries featuring characters and scenes from favorite movies and TV shows are a common sight in teen bedrooms.
  • Sports: For sports enthusiasts, jerseys, team logos, and action shots of favorite athletes adorn their walls.
  • Travel and Nature: Travel posters, maps, and nature-inspired artwork create a sense of adventure and escapism.
  • Abstract and Geometric Designs: These designs offer a modern and minimalist aesthetic, appealing to teens who prefer clean lines and bold patterns.

Popular Styles

Teen bedroom wall decor styles reflect the diverse tastes and preferences of this generation.

  • Bohemian: Bohemian style embraces a mix of patterns, textures, and colors, creating a free-spirited and eclectic atmosphere.
  • Minimalist: Minimalist style prioritizes simplicity and functionality, with clean lines and neutral colors.
  • Industrial: Industrial style features exposed brick, metal accents, and vintage elements, creating a rugged and urban feel.
  • Modern: Modern style emphasizes clean lines, geometric shapes, and bold colors, creating a contemporary and sophisticated look.
  • Vintage: Vintage style incorporates retro elements like posters, record players, and old-fashioned furniture, creating a nostalgic and charming atmosphere.

Popular Materials

The materials used for teen bedroom wall decor are as diverse as the styles themselves.

  • Posters: Posters are a classic and affordable way to personalize a teen’s bedroom. They come in a wide range of themes, styles, and sizes.
  • Tapestries: Tapestries are woven fabrics that can add color, texture, and a touch of bohemian flair to a room.
  • Artwork: Artwork, whether paintings, prints, or photographs, can add a personal touch and elevate the overall aesthetic of a teen’s bedroom.
  • Wall Shelves: Wall shelves provide a functional and decorative way to display books, plants, and other personal items.
  • Fairy Lights: Fairy lights add a touch of magic and ambiance to a teen’s bedroom, creating a cozy and inviting atmosphere.

A teen’s bedroom is their sanctuary, a reflection of their unique personality and interests. It’s a space where they can express themselves freely, unwind, and recharge. Creating a personalized bedroom decor plan goes beyond just aesthetics; it’s about fostering a sense of belonging and self-expression.

Incorporating Personal Touches

A personalized bedroom decor plan starts with incorporating elements that resonate with the teen’s individuality. This can include photos, mementos, and DIY projects that hold special meaning.

  • Photos: Displaying cherished photos of friends, family, and special moments creates a warm and inviting atmosphere. Consider using a photo collage wall, a gallery wall, or a photo frame grid to showcase these memories.
  • Mementos: Incorporate mementos that represent hobbies, interests, or significant events. This could include concert tickets, travel souvenirs, or awards received. These items add a personal touch and serve as reminders of meaningful experiences.
  • DIY Projects: Encourage the teen to express their creativity through DIY projects. They can create personalized artwork, wall hangings, or even design their own furniture. This hands-on approach adds a unique touch and reflects their individual style.

Creating a Cohesive Design

Creating a cohesive and visually appealing design involves combining different decor elements harmoniously. Here are some tips to achieve a balanced and aesthetically pleasing space:

  • Color Palette: Start by choosing a color palette that complements the teen’s personality and interests. A neutral base color can be used as a backdrop, while accent colors can be incorporated through pillows, throws, and artwork.
  • Theme: Consider incorporating a theme that reflects the teen’s passions, such as music, sports, travel, or art. This can be achieved through artwork, posters, and accessories.
  • Balance: Ensure a balance between different decor elements. Avoid overcrowding the space with too many items. Leave some blank walls to create visual breathing room.
  • Lighting: Proper lighting is crucial for creating a welcoming and functional space. Use a combination of natural and artificial light sources to illuminate the room effectively.

Wall-Mounted Storage Solutions

Wall-mounted storage solutions are a game-changer for teen bedrooms, offering a stylish and efficient way to keep belongings organized. They maximize vertical space, freeing up valuable floor area for furniture and movement.

  • Floating Shelves: Floating shelves are a popular choice, providing a minimalist and modern look. They are perfect for displaying books, photos, plants, and decorative items. Floating shelves can be arranged in various configurations to suit the room’s design and storage needs.
  • Wall-Mounted Baskets: Wall-mounted baskets are ideal for storing smaller items like toiletries, stationery, or accessories. They add a touch of rustic charm and provide easy access to frequently used items.
  • Pegboards: Pegboards are versatile and adaptable, offering a customizable storage solution. They can be used to hang tools, jewelry, bags, or even artwork. Pegboards are particularly useful for teens who need to organize their workspace or craft supplies.

Organizers

Organizers can be incorporated into the bedroom’s design to create a sense of order and enhance functionality. These wall-mounted solutions help keep items neatly arranged and easily accessible.

  • Magazine Racks: Magazine racks are perfect for holding magazines, notebooks, or even small plants. They add a touch of sophistication and provide a dedicated space for keeping reading materials organized.
  • Wall-Mounted Jewelry Organizers: Jewelry organizers are a must-have for teens who love accessorizing. They offer a stylish and convenient way to keep necklaces, bracelets, and earrings organized and tangle-free.
  • Key Hooks: Key hooks are a practical and stylish solution for keeping keys, bags, or hats organized. They are often mounted near the door for easy access and add a decorative element to the wall.

Lighting Fixtures, Teen bedroom wall decor

Lighting plays a crucial role in setting the mood and functionality of a teen’s bedroom. Wall-mounted lighting fixtures can add a touch of elegance and provide practical illumination.

  • Sconces: Sconces are elegant wall-mounted light fixtures that provide ambient lighting. They are perfect for illuminating reading nooks or adding a touch of sophistication to the room.
  • String Lights: String lights are a popular choice for creating a cozy and whimsical atmosphere. They can be draped across the wall, headboard, or even around a mirror to add a touch of magic to the room.
  • Wall-Mounted Lamps: Wall-mounted lamps offer a space-saving solution, providing focused lighting for reading or studying. They are available in various styles to complement the room’s decor.
